This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in United States.
• Deliver remote technical assistance to customers, technicians, and field sales teams for equipment utilized in practitioners' offices.
• Evaluate, diagnose, troubleshoot, and resolve technical problems from a distance.
• Offer remote repair services, including the escalation of complex or challenging issues.
• Supervise the Early Warning System, conduct trend analysis, reach out to customers, address issues remotely, and arrange for field technicians.
• Adhere to troubleshooting protocols and suggest solutions to enhance customer satisfaction.
• Serve as an EST Mentor, providing support, guidance, and training to new employees and junior technicians.
• Generate timely and comprehensive service reports.
• Participate in necessary career development and manufacturer technical training sessions.
• Update team members and HUB dispatchers on assignment progress.
• Finalize and close work orders each day, documenting calls, tasks completed, and parts requested or needed, and submit for billing.
• Engage in special projects and undertake additional responsibilities as required.
• Act as a liaison between Henry Schein, customers, contractors, and EPM.
• Typically requires 7 or more years of relevant experience.
• Generally holds a Bachelor's Degree or global equivalent in a related field (preferred qualification).
• Proficient troubleshooting abilities.
• Strong mechanical expertise.
• Experience in service and installation.
• Knowledge level equivalent to a Senior Technician.
• Capability to mentor fellow technicians.
• Competence in leading technician roles.
• Advanced computer proficiency.
• Must possess cross-certifications in digital x-ray/software, digital CAD/CAM, or related areas.
• Strong oral communication and presentation skills.
• Ability to handle confidential information.
• Capacity to work independently as well as collaboratively in a team setting.
• Skilled in managing intricate issues, conflicts, multiple projects, and performing effectively under pressure.
• Good analytical, problem-solving, time-management, prioritization, and organizational skills.
• Opportunity to work remotely from home.
• Travel required is typically less than 10%.
